Hat Chrome einen timeout-selbst für web-service-Aufrufe?
Vor dem Aufruf einer web-service von meine-web-app, habe ich ein bestimmtes Zeitlimit, nach dem, wenn ich nicht bekommen keine Antwort, wird der Anruf endet.
Was ist, wenn ich das timeout auf, zum Beispiel, 10', ist da ein timeout, nach dem Chrome nicht wollen, zu warten, für diese Antwort?
Dank
InformationsquelleAutor eeadev | 2017-03-24
Du musst angemeldet sein, um einen Kommentar abzugeben.
Einem webservice-Aufruf wird eine normale HTTP-Aufruf, so dass es betroffenen, die von browser-Einstellungen über http.
Ich schlage vor, Sie sehen diese Antworten :
Allzweck-Antwort :
Wo finde ich die Standard-timeout-Einstellungen für alle Browser?
Chrome fokussiert Antwort :
https://superuser.com/questions/633648/how-can-i-change-the-default-website-connection-timeout-in-chrome
Leider AFAIK gibt es keine Einstellung, erhältlich in Chrom, um den timeout einstellen.
Da die Letzte Antwort zu dem Thema, ich glaube nicht, dass Google hat sich verbessert, aber du könntest zumindest versuchen, die registry-Ansatz beschrieben :
Erstellen Sie KeepAliveTimeout und ServerInfoTimeout keys in H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\InternetSettings mit dem gewünschten Wert in ms, und prüfen Sie, ob es hilft.
Darüber hinaus sehr lange http-Aufrufe sind nicht ein sehr gutes design. Wenn es eine option, könnte es interessant sein, zu überarbeiten, die server-Prozess-und Kommunikations-Methode, um eine Art "keep alive ping", die zum Beispiel zum anzeigen des Fortschritts im client-browser statt frieren Sie für 10 Minuten.
InformationsquelleAutor AFract